-
Angular Formcontrol Set Focus, To 5 tips on using Angular FormControl We often learn Angular presented with two options for working with forms: Template driven or reactive (or I think the second answer comes closest to what you're asking for How to set focus on input field? Instead of binding a boolean "should be focused" field, the directive uses events to set While it's possible to focus an element with the autocomplete attribute, I found that creating an Angular Directive is more convenient. I need for the users to be able to go through the steps entirely using the keyboard, without FormControl takes a single generic argument, which describes the type of its value. The focus and blur events are opposite to each other. Instead of the popular ElementRef solution, we will use Renderer2 to set This is one of the four fundamental building blocks of Angular forms, along with FormGroup, FormArray and FormRecord. focus ()` right after creating the control will fail, as Angular hasn’t yet rendered the element. Here's an example using ViewChild and In this blog, we’ll explore a step-by-step solution to programmatically set focus on dynamically created FormControl elements using Angular’s reactive forms, ViewChildren, and When the directive's selector is set to form, every form in the application will automatically focus the first form control. It extends the AbstractControl class that implements most of the base functionality You cannot set to a FormControl or AbstractControl, since they aren't DOM elements. I came here to see if there is a way to set focus to a textbox, I am not On this page we will provide focus and blur events example with Angular FormControl. In How to set focus on the control from angular diretive Asked 4 years, 10 months ago Modified 4 years, 10 months ago Viewed 480 times While it’s possible to focus an element with the autocomplete attribute, I found that creating an Angular Directive is more convenient. When the directive's selector is set to form, every Angular 6 Reactive Forms : How to set focus on first invalid input Asked 7 years, 3 months ago Modified 3 years, 9 months ago Viewed 73k times. In this blog, we’ll explore a step-by-step solution to In my app I want to automatically set focus on first field of form on component load. In Angular, you can set focus on a specific FormControl within a FormArray by using a combination of ViewChild and Renderer2 or by using a custom directive. When the Focus using FormControlName as selector Asked 7 years, 9 months ago Modified 5 years, 11 months ago Viewed 3k times Hey I cannot refrence the newly created formControl with the dom as it is lagging by one row every time, it is caused due to the sync and async behaviour but cannot figure out how to over This means naive attempts to call `. This argument always implicitly includes null because the control can be reset. Describe the solution you'd like Starter project for Angular apps that exports to the Angular CLI I am using Angular 9 and Material. What you'd need to do is have an element reference to them, somehow, and call . The directive below also I came here to see if there is a way to set focus to a textbox, I am not calling it FormControl because to the user, it is just a text box, and he expects the In this post, I will show you how to programmatically set focus on a form control in Angular. FormControl takes a single generic argument, which describes the type of its value. I was working on a side project with a lot of forms and want a simple way to set focus to a specific form control on each page/view when the page/view loads. The code snippet below is my I am still trying to figure out why Angular was deliberately made complex. Can anyone please guide how to achieve this without any repetition as I want this on every form 🚀 feature request Relevant Package This feature request is for @angular/forms Description The FormControl class does not have a FOCUS method. I have a Stepper that will guide users through the steps to do our workflow. focus () on that. qw wp5m 2lo 8cu kqb bfpwti qfa57k r5 yvfzelncf 44oy